What is Electronics & Communication ++?
The ECE ++ program includes the complete core ECE curriculum plus additional advanced components, such as:
-
Industry-oriented skill modules
-
Advanced hands-on lab work and live projects
-
Training in embedded systems, IoT, and communication technologies
-
Soft skills, aptitude, and career preparation workshops
This makes the ECE ++ program more practical, application-oriented, and aligned with industry requirements than a regular ECE program.
Curriculum & Learning Approach
The curriculum blends theoretical learning with hands-on training, live projects, and industry exposure.
Core Subjects
-
Electronic Devices & Circuits
-
Analog & Digital Electronics
-
Signals & Systems
-
Communication Systems
-
Microprocessors & Microcontrollers
-
Embedded Systems & IoT
-
VLSI & Digital Signal Processing (DSP)
-
Wireless, Optical & Satellite Communication

Core Electronics & Communication Roles
Graduates can work in core ECE fields, including:
-
Electronics Engineer – Designing and testing electronic circuits and systems
-
Communication Engineer – Working on wireless, optical, and network communication technologies
-
Embedded Systems Engineer – Programming microcontrollers, IoT devices, and automation systems
-
VLSI / Chip Design Engineer – Entry-level roles in semiconductor and chip manufacturing
-
Network & Telecom Engineer – Working in telecom and networking companies
These roles are available in electronics, telecom, IT hardware, and embedded systems companies.

Government Jobs & Public Sector
ECE ++ graduates can apply for:
-
PSU roles (BHEL, DRDO, ISRO, BEL, BSNL)
-
UPSC Engineering Services (IES)
-
Telecom and IT-related government organizations
